SEALSQ Quantum Vision With Miraex SA Photonics Acquisition

Posted on March 25, 2026 by agarapuramesh5 min read
SEALSQ Quantum Vision With Miraex SA Photonics Acquisition

SEALSQ Corp has declared its intention to purchase 100% of the equity interest in Miraex SA, a Swiss-based leader in photonics-based quantum interconnect systems, in a move that portends a significant consolidation in the European technology scene. This historic acquisition, made possible by the SEALSQ Quantum Fund, represents a significant growth for the cybersecurity company as it works to create the first fully integrated “Quantum Vertical Stack” in history. The agreement, which was made public on March 2026, intends to advance the business into the field of planetary-scale quantum infrastructure rather than just individual semiconductor components.

Strategic Acquisition and Exclusivity

A 60-day exclusivity period is included in the signed Letter of Intent (LOI), during which SEALSQ and Miraex shall negotiate final deal documentation and carry out confirmatory due diligence. With its headquarters located in the esteemed EPFL Innovation Park in Ecublens, Switzerland, Miraex has reached legally binding agreements. Subject to the fulfillment of typical closing conditions and regulatory procedures relevant to such high-tech acquisitions, the deal is anticipated to be finalized by the end of June 2026.

A well-known pioneer in post-quantum semiconductor and cybersecurity technologies, SEALSQ is a division of WISeKey International Holding Ltd (NASDAQ: WKEY). The company plans to realize its vision of a vertically integrated technology stack and bolster its strategic investment program by incorporating Miraex.

Miraex: The “Connective Tissue” of Quantum

Thin Film Lithium Tantalate (TFLT) Photonic Integrated Circuits (PICs) are the area of expertise for deep-tech pioneer Miraex. This patented technological platform serves as a crucial hardware layer that enables the conversion, transmission, and linking of quantum information across future quantum networks and distinct quantum computers.

Scalability is currently a major problem for the sector. The number of qubits that individual quantum processors can sustain is typically their limit, notwithstanding their successful development. These processors need to be connected to cooperate to address complicated global issues. The majority of superconducting quantum computers use microwave signals at temperatures close to absolute zero, yet quantum information is extremely delicate. The capacity of Miraex to function as a high-efficiency translator, transforming these microwave quantum states into optical photons the preferred medium for long-distance communication via fiber optics or satellite links without losing their “quantumness” is what makes it so special.

Completing the Quantum Vertical Stack

The entire range of quantum technology, from microscopic chips to global network designs, is encompassed in SEALSQ’s concept for its Quantum Vertical Stack. Three different levels of expertise will now be possessed by the united entity:

  • The Security Layer: Based on SEALSQ’s current Root of Trust (RoT) services and Post-Quantum Cryptography (PQC) chips. The purpose of these “Quantum Shield” chips is to safeguard traditional data against the impending threat of quantum computers.
  • The Interconnect Layer: This layer bridges hardware and networks using Miraex‘s microwave-to-optical transduction technology.
  • The Network Layer: Enabling the construction of globally entangled quantum networks, which will serve as the foundation for the Quantum Internet of the future.

According to Carlos Moreira, CEO of SEALSQ, Miraex is precisely the kind of fundamental asset needed to connect the organization’s networking, computing, and cryptographic capabilities into a cohesive architecture.

Three Pillars of Innovation

Three crucial quantum verticals are added to SEALSQ’s portfolio by the acquisition:

  • Distributed Quantum Computing (DQS): This technology makes it possible for several smaller quantum computers to “talk” to each other at the speed of light, functioning as a single, enormous calculating unit.
  • Quantum Sensing: Miraex creates incredibly accurate sensors for geophysics, aircraft, and defense using photonic entanglement. These sensors can function in situations where GPS is not available or where extremely precise detection of magnetic anomalies is required.
  • Quantum Networking: Under the rules of quantum mechanics, this pillar focuses on creating the framework for physically secure communication that cannot be intercepted without notice.

Expanding into the “Orbital Cloud”

The SEALSQ Quantum Spatial Orbital Cloud (QSOC) project is a key factor in the acquisition. The goal of this flagship project is to provide quantum-secure capabilities throughout Low Earth Orbit (LEO) and beyond. Because Miraex‘s TFLT PICs are small, power-efficient, and naturally radiation-tolerant essential characteristics for satellite payloads they are especially well-suited for this mission.

SEALSQ anticipates accelerating its goal of expanding quantum-secure infrastructure throughout terrestrial and space-based ecosystems by incorporating this technology into nanosatellites and CubeSats. By establishing quantum entanglement between satellites and ground stations, this space-grade integration successfully circumvents the distance constraints of conventional terrestrial fiber optics.

Addressing the “Quantum Threat”

The growing “Quantum Threat” is the larger industrial context for this transaction. Conventional encryption techniques like RSA and Elliptic Curve Cryptography (ECC) are become more susceptible as quantum computers develop. In a number of areas, including medical and healthcare systems, automotive (EV charging), smart energy, and industrial automation, SEALSQ is leading the way in the development of post-quantum semiconductors that offer strong, future-proof protection for sensitive data.

SEALSQ makes sure that businesses are safe from these new risks by integrating Post-Quantum Cryptography into its semiconductor products. To assist businesses in navigating this shift, the company’s “Quantum Lab” also provides services including Quantum as a Service and best practice consultancy.

The Path Forward

The CEO of Miraex, Daniel Brau, expressed hope for the collaboration between the two companies, saying that SEALSQ’s global presence and semiconductor know-how will speed up Miraex’s goal of connecting quantum on a planetary scale. This acquisition represents a shift in the tech sector from experimental research to commercial infrastructure.

When the integration of Miraex’s technology is finished, SEALSQ’s end-to-end platform should perform better and be more resilient. Traveling wave transducer designs are among the proprietary patents held by Miraex, a member of the Swiss National Startup Team, guaranteeing that SEALSQ stays at the forefront of the second quantum revolution. SEALSQ is not only safeguarding data by securing the “connective tissue” supplied by Miraex, but it is also constructing the high-speed highway that quantum information will use for decades to come.
